你查询的IP:[121.51.58.151]  地理位置:中国–上海–上海

最新查询125.215.66.55 124.31.229.57 120.52.52.245 219.82.8.11 121.32.85.162 61.232.42.231 120.48.11.196 120.94.84.163 116.196.84.41 121.51.58.151 117.106.177.206 202.127.208.79 120.136.128.32 124.160.34.20 125.31.192.229 211.144.205.123 210.76.7.57 202.165.208.239 221.14.111.197 119.27.160.90 116.214.64.10 202.136.224.193 222.126.128.4 61.236.7.43 203.134.240.109 119.4.243.17 119.42.136.121 203.166.160.109 117.106.222.38 123.8.49.192 120.72.32.209